Transaction 03623ebea40ab461b1beb2a3ff89e381f3ef9cdf960aa921c6b75e6429046f79
1 Input
1 Output
-
03623ebea40ab461b1beb2a3ff89e381f3ef9cdf960aa921c6b75e6429046f79:0
- value
- 179612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68105b6ad07d84e0261546391ebdbb7d01f123b3 OP_EQUAL
- address
- 3BBFo1FvcS66LEswqg3XkXYgzuv21cv5tu